Read allThree officers are tasked with escorting an illegal immigrant to Charles de Gaulle airport, where he will be forced onto a plane and sent back to his homeland. But when they find out about the truth, they have to make a difficult choice.Three officers are tasked with escorting an illegal immigrant to Charles de Gaulle airport, where he will be forced onto a plane and sent back to his homeland. But when they find out about the truth, they have to make a difficult choice.

Solid Police Drama that Questions your morals and believes, well at least it does it with the leading characters. A trio of Police men and women have to do extra Hours to escort a supposably criminal to the Airport for Deportation. But the night doesnt go as planned....
Anne Fontaine directs this character Drama and explores the Souls of the three main protagonists. Showing their lives, how they believe in Things and how everything gets turned around. The acting is good. Omar Sy is the most prominent cast member and he does well, although he leaves the Spotlight for his female co-star Virginie Efira, who steals the Show and owns the movie with her great Performance. Also Gregory Gadebois delivers a very good Performance. Fontaine Chose the shakey camera element to tell her Story. In my opinion not 100% neccessairy because I think with a regular cinematography the film had made a better Impact. This decision was rather a bit distracting. STill a good Moral piece, and one of those films that Questions the audience: "What would you have done?"
